Electrical Contracting

Certified electricians are in short supply, and every new build plus every ECG problem creates work.

Licensing & permits

The compliance path in Ghana, from registration through to sector regulators.

  1. 1Reserve the name and register the business at the Office of the Registrar of Companies (ORC)
  2. 2Get a TIN linked to your Ghana Card and register for tax at the nearest GRA office
  3. 3Apply for a Business Operating Permit from your Metropolitan, Municipal or District Assembly
  4. 4Get a development and building permit from the Assembly's physical planning department
  5. 5Register with the Ministry of Works and Housing classification scheme to bid for contracts
  6. 6Obtain an EPA permit and take contractors' all-risk insurance for larger sites
  7. 7Certify electricians with the Energy Commission's electrical wiring certification scheme

Risk assessment

01

Client payment delays and retention held for months

02

Material price escalation mid-contract

03

Site accidents and liability without proper insurance

04

Land title disputes stalling a project entirely

Marketing strategies

  1. 1Register on GhanaTenders and Assembly supplier rolls for public contracts
  2. 2Photograph every finished job and keep a portfolio on WhatsApp and Instagram
  3. 3Build relationships with architects and estate developers who feed work
  4. 4Quote fast and in writing — most jobs are lost to slow quotes

Fees, levies and permit requirements change. Confirm the current position with the Office of the Registrar of Companies, the Ghana Revenue Authority and your Metropolitan, Municipal or District Assembly before you spend.
